I am not sure that hybrids are the answer. Why? Check the energy balance. You need to manufacture the batteries, recycle them when they are weak and add the cost of replacement when they are worn out. When you recharge with the wall outlet, the efficiency of the power generation also comes into play. Hybrids just move the costs from oil to other methods of producing energy, some of which are as detrimental to mankind as burning fossil fuels.
